What is 'Alis'?

Alis (Advanced List Service) is the service IRCnet uses to allow you to search for channels. It is a replacement for the /LIST IRC command.

See the FAQ for information on LIST and why Alis is used instead.

Quickstart

(Trillian and Gaim users should take special care that they read the How does 'alis' work? -section below too.)

Lists all channels with the channelname containing "help":

/SQUERY ALIS LIST *help* 

Lists all channels with a minimum of 10 users and the word "help" in the topic:

/SQUERY ALIS LIST * -min 10 -topic help

How does 'alis' work?

/SQUERY ALIS command arguments

On some IRC clients, SQUERY does not work that easilly by default, then you have to use (notice the colon):

/SQUERY ALIS :command arguments

or even (known to work in Trillian and Gaim):

/QUOTE SQUERY ALIS :command arguments

You can get some help on alis with the following command:

/SQUERY ALIS HELP

A particular usefull command is:

/SQUERY ALIS HELP EXAMPLES

For a full list of command arguments for the alis LIST command:

/SQUERY ALIS HELP LIST

Semi-technical notes

Alis honours the secret/private ( s and p) channels, we only get to see the visible ones.

As it is right now it is impossible to list more than the first 60 channels that matches a given search (This is fixed in a more recent beta-version, but it is not used on IRCnet.)

There is also a slight issue with case-sensitivity, you can not match against uppercase text in a topic.

IRCnet uses Alis version 2.4.
